Optimising your copy

There are a number of ways you can boost the efficiency of your copy, but the best ways I have learnt involve a combo of techniques, all of which I now explain:

  1. Use Bullets – they may be a classic but they are still an effective way to show your surfer a multitude of benfits all in quick succession (such as I am doing now lol).
  2. Bolding – by identifying keywords or pieces of critical text within your copy you can help your surfers to spot your benefits, even when they are scan down the page.
  3. Hyperlinks – it is important to be careful with your colour choices here. Making your hyperlinks blue has been proven to be the most productive way to grab your surfers attention. Plus blue, underlined words are widely known across the web to be hyperlinks.
  4. Sub-headlines – not only do these prevent your copy from becoming bulky, but they are a clever way to help your surfers to scan down to the most relevants sections of your copy. Just be careful to use your sub-headers properly and ensure they accurately surmise the following content.
  5. White Space – this phrase you are probably unfamiliar with, but it does matter. All it is is the spacing you put between paragraphs of copy. By breaking your paragraphs up, this will make it easier for your surfers to find information and make your copy look less intimidating.
  6. Jargon – the biggest killer of copy is filling it with too many technical words. Why? Because not all your surfers will understand what they mean, thus inhibiting them from taking the next step. If you really need to contain technical words, give your surfers the option of reading a glossary or FAQ page.
